27x1-1/4 were very common into the early '80's. I just bought a new tube (Continental) from my LBS for my 1981 vintage 27x1-1/4 wheels, they showed me the box which listed the compatible sizes: 700C, 27x1-1/4, 1-1/8. etc. Mine are presta valves. Tires are harder to find, but not rare in most cases.
